Why These Are the Top Toyota Repair Auto Repair Shops in Sacramento

** The Toyota repair market for residents of Sacramento, KY is entirely reliant on providers in Owensboro. The market in Owensboro is robust and competitive, offering a clear choice between the factory-backed expertise of the dealership and several well-established, highly competent independent specialists. * **Average Quality:** The quality of specialized Toyota service is high in Owensboro. Both the dealership and the top independents employ certified technicians with access to professional-grade tools and information. * **Competition Level:** Competition is healthy. The dealership holds the advantage for warranty work, complex hybrid/electronic issues, and recall services. Independent shops compete effectively on price for out-of-warranty repairs (e.g., engine, transmission, general maintenance) and often provide a more personalized customer experience. *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ing follows the industry standard. The dealership typically commands the highest labor rates. Independent specialists generally offer rates 15-25% lower, while still using high-quality parts. For the specialized services requested (hybrid, CVT, performance), consumers should expect premium pricing regardless of the provider due to the required expertise and technology.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about toyota repair services in Sacramento, KY

What are the most common Toyota repair issues for drivers in the Sacramento, Kentucky area?

Given the rural roads and seasonal temperature shifts, Sacramento-area Toyotas often need suspension repairs for worn shocks/struts and tire alignments due to rough terrain. Engines, particularly in older models, may also develop issues from idling during cold snaps or from dust and pollen affecting air intake systems.

How can I find a reliable, specialized Toyota repair shop near Sacramento, KY?

Since Sacramento is a smaller community, look for shops in nearby larger towns like Madisonville or Princeton that employ ASE-certified technicians with specific Toyota training. Check online reviews and ask for local referrals to find mechanics experienced with models commonly driven in our region, like the Tacoma, Camry, and Highlander.

Are repair costs at the local Toyota dealership in Hopkinsville higher than at independent shops serving Sacramento?

Yes, the dealership typically has higher labor rates, but it uses OEM parts and has technicians with direct factory training. For major repairs like hybrid system service or complex computer diagnostics, the dealership may be worth it, but for general maintenance, a trusted local independent shop can offer significant savings.

When should I seek immediate service for my Toyota in this region?

Seek immediate service if you notice warning lights (like the check engine or oil light), unusual noises from the brakes or suspension on our country roads, or overheating, especially before tackling longer drives to Hopkinsville or Paducah. Addressing small issues quickly prevents costly breakdowns on less-traveled rural routes.

What local factors in the Sacramento area should influence my Toyota's maintenance schedule?

The dusty agricultural environment means air and cabin filters should be changed more frequently. Furthermore, the humidity and use of road treatments in winter can accelerate corrosion, making undercarriage inspections and washes important. Planning maintenance around the harsh summer heat and winter cold will also improve reliability.
